Getting Started with a Canadian Online Casino: Registration and Verification
First things first: creating an account. Most canadian online casino platforms ask for a name, email, birthdate, and a password. Choose a strong password – a mix of letters, numbers and symbols – because security starts at login.
After you hit “register,” the verification step (often called KYC) kicks in. You’ll be asked to upload a government‑issued ID and a proof‑of‑address document such as a utility bill. The process can take from a few minutes to 48 hours, depending on the casino’s workload. Keeping your documents clear and legible speeds things up.
Understanding Bonuses and Wagering Requirements
Bonuses are the main lure for many canadian online casino enthusiasts. The most common is the welcome bonus – usually a match on your first deposit plus some free spins. Read the fine print: a 100 % match on a $100 deposit sounds great, but if the wagering requirement is 40× the bonus, you’ll need to bet $4,000 before you can withdraw.
Other promotional offers include reload bonuses, cash‑back deals, and loyalty points. Keep a spreadsheet if you chase many offers; it helps you see which bonus actually gives the best value after you factor in the wagering requirements, game restrictions and expiration dates.
Choosing Payment Methods and Withdrawal Speed
Canadians have a few favourite deposit routes: Interac e‑Transfer, credit/debit cards, and e‑wallets like Skrill or Neteller. Interac is popular because it links directly to your bank and usually processes deposits instantly.
When it comes to withdrawals, speed varies. E‑wallets often deliver “instant payouts,” while bank transfers can take 3‑5 business days. Some casinos even offer crypto‑free options such as prepaid cards for faster cash‑out. Below is a quick comparison of common methods.
- Interac e‑Transfer – Instant deposit, 1‑3 business days withdrawal.
- Credit/Debit Card – Instant deposit, 2‑4 business days withdrawal.
- E‑wallet (Skrill, Neteller) – Instant both ways.
- Prepaid Card – Near‑instant deposit, 1‑2 business days withdrawal.

Safety, Licensing, and Responsible Gambling
Safety starts with licensing. Reputable canadian online casino sites are licensed by bodies such as the Kahnawake Gaming Commission, the Malta Gaming Authority, or a provincial regulator like the Ontario Lottery and Gaming Corporation. A licence number should be clearly displayed in the footer.
Responsible gambling tools – deposit limits, self‑exclusion, and reality checks – are mandatory in Canada. Set a weekly budget and stick to it. If you ever feel a game is getting out of hand, most sites provide a “take a break” link that instantly blocks your account for a chosen period.
